SoundGlass Miami, Florida

Started out with brothers Anthony Michael (Bass / Vocals) and Thomas Dean Maestu (Drums/ Background Vocals), jamming in a spare bedroom in their home.

The two brothers recruited guitarists Jevon Olea and Jose Mena in July of 2013, both fixtures of the South Florida Music scene. They officially became SoundGlass, blending pop, punk and radio ready rock.
